Apple's Vision Pro is a bold product with advanced augmented reality features for entertainment, productivity, and gaming. If you have been waiting for the launch, the Apple Vision Pro will be available starting February 2 in the United States. The company will continue to expand the launch in additional regions in the coming months ahead of the WWDC 2024 event.
